Minnesota rules behind a Clearbrook personal loan

Below are the Minnesota rules that apply to a loan made in Clearbrook, each with the regulator that issued it.

Payday lending statusLegal and licensed; APR capped at 36%, or up to 50% with an ability-to-repay analysis (Minn. Stat. §§ 47.60, 47.601, 47.603)
Source says: "The cap on that annual percentage rate is set at either 36%, or up to 50% if the lender conducts an ability to repay analysis"

Small-loan / installment lender licensingRegulated loan license required from the commissioner for loans within the Chapter 56 threshold (Minn. Stat. § 56.01)
Source says: "without first obtaining a license from the commissioner, no person shall engage in the business of making loans of money"

Common questions

What are my options in Clearbrook if my credit is poor?
Borrowing is still possible, but expect a higher APR and a smaller approved amount. Lenders that accept lower scores hold statewide licences, so what is open to you in Clearbrook is the same as anywhere in Minnesota.
What loan size can I expect in Clearbrook?
Most personal loans sit somewhere between $1,000 and $50,000, though the figure you are approved for turns on the lender, your income and your credit. Model the monthly payment first with our personal loan calculator.
Do I have to pledge anything to borrow in Clearbrook?
For an unsecured personal loan, no — there is nothing to pledge. A secured loan, such as home equity or one secured by a vehicle, does require collateral, and default puts that asset at risk.
Does comparing loans in Clearbrook cost me credit score points?
Not during pre-qualification, which normally uses a soft pull and leaves your score alone. Submitting a full application triggers a hard inquiry, which can trim a few points briefly.
